hi,
I m getting Runtime Errors MESSAGE_TYPE_UNKNOWN while displaying message in status bar.
I have written the message statement like this
Message e000(mid) display like 'S'.
where mid is type of message id..
can anybody tell the solution to display message in status bar

hi,
mid is supposed to be the message class.
either you specify the message class here or in the report statement.

Try this.
TABLES: mara.
SELECT-OPTIONS: s_matnr FOR mara-matnr.
INITIALIZATION.
At SELECTION-SCREEN.
MESSAGE 'This is message in selection screen' TYPE 'E' DISPLAY LIKE 'S'.
START-OF-SELECTION.
END-OF-SELECTION.
2010 Dec 23 9:57 AM
Place your message under AT SELECTION-SCREEN event. This would keep your status message on the screen itself.
